Random acts of kindness are unexpected things we can do to brighten up other people’s days. While these aren’t activities that typically take a lot of time, they can be very meaningful to the recipient. Performing random acts of kindness can help improve the atmosphere at your workplace.

We went through a few global blog articles that had ideas for this and came across three that seemed to be the most appropriate in a Sri Lankan context.

1. Help an officemate with a difficult or unpleasant task without being asked.

2. Buy a drink or snack for the support staff or security desk (they deserve it!) or leave it on a co-worker’s desk.

3. Send a note to the boss about something spectacular that a colleague has recently done at work or give someone a genuine recommendation on LinkedIn.
